FESS, J.

This is an appeal on questions of law from a judgment for defendant entered by the court after trial without the intervention of a jury.

The action was brought by plaintiff against the defendant to recover $4,000 under a policy of insurance insuring the life of his son, who met his death while in the air corps as a result of the crash of a training plane.
